Located at 13 Rue Saint-Germain on the left bank of Paris, the cafe is 330 years old.
Its die-hard fans pull out an absolute all-star lineup: Napoleon, Rousseau, Voltaire, Hemingway, Diderot, Hugo, Balzac. Almost all the celebrities of the 17th and 18th centuries drank coffee here.

In 1686, a Sicilian named Le Procope began the legendary journey of the cafe. Now the cafe is 330 years old.
Le Procope Cafe, which began in 1686
Le Procope Cafe, located at 13 Rue Saint-Germain in Paris. In the Middle Ages, it was the heart of the left bank of Paris, and daily life was quite lively.
At that time, Louis XIV moved to Versailles, and the left bank became the only way from Paris to Versailles, entering the golden period of development. At that time, dignitaries and celebrities came here to build mansions, gradually forming a middle-class community.
It was at this moment that Le Procope began its legendary journey in the prime location on the left bank of the Seine.
History has once again proved that the prime location is everlasting and the century-old shop will last forever.

At the main entrance of the cafe, in the window on one side is the shop's "treasure of the town shop"-Napoleon's iconic hat.
The hat that Napoleon used to mortgage coffee money.
I stopped in front of the window to watch, the waiter watched, and enthusiastically introduced the story of the hat:
According to legend, when Napoleon was a young officer, he came here one day for coffee, and because he had no money with him, he put this hat here to pay the bill.
At that time, no one would have thought that the young man who could not afford the coffee would become the founder of Napoleon's empire.
The story was simple, but the waiter spoke eloquently, as if to witness the embarrassment that the little man could not afford to pay at that time.
Le Procope took this story out of many sage stories and painted it into a wealth cat for the history and brand of the cafe.

Yes, the oldest cafe has now been transformed into a curry restaurant, and the number outside has changed from caf é to Restaurant.
Transformed into a coffee restaurant, coffee + traditional French food
In addition to coffee, the menu also serves traditional French dishes such as braised chicken and snails.
The name of the signature dish who relies on the old to sell the old is: 1686.
Of course, French food still plays the historical star card. One of the most famous is the "philosopher set meal", with appetizers, entrees and desserts made entirely in the traditional way.
A set meal costs about 35 euros. The price is moderate, the quantity of food is OK, but it is not exquisite enough and the taste is beyond circle.
Have a cup of coffee, of course. In fact, that's why most people come here.
I ordered a Nespresso.
After drinking, it can be said for sure that this old shop has lived for three long centuries, and it definitely does not depend on the quality of coffee.

Le Procope Cafe has a long-running slogan: a place for artists to date with writers.
When I walked into the lobby, the walls were covered with portraits of great men. Those who look familiar are Voltaire, Rousseau, Diderot, Hugo, Balzac and so on.
Without exception, these bigwigs are all "die-hard fans" advertised by Le Procope Cafe.
In the corner near the window on the second floor, there is still a chair with Hemingway's name engraved on the back of the chair, called Hemingway's chair. It is said that Hemingway completed his "Sun Rises as usual" in this chair.
In the other corner is Voltaire's desk marked "King of French thought", where he brewed the Enlightenment.
Voltaire's desk, in the corner of the cafe.
The address of the bathroom has the characteristics of the 18th century. It does not write "Toilettes" or "WC", but "Commodit é", meaning "convenience". The elegant expression in French is like "changing" in Chinese.
The bathroom door is marked with "Citoyen" (male citizen) and "Citoyenne" (female citizen) respectively.
Standing in front of the door, what you smell is the history of the French Revolution.
